York Hospital has a new opening for a Prescription Assistance Counselor. This is a full-time, 40 hour per week opening and is located in York, Maine.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  1. Facilitate the initial application and renewal process with patients for pharmaceutical patient assistance programs. Coordinate with York Hospital providers to complete the necessary paperwork.
  2. Provide other resources to patients for help with prescription drug costs such as plan education, manufacturer co-pay cards, low-cost generic drug programs, and independent co-pay assistance foundations.
  3. Serve as a knowledgeable resource for hospital staff regarding prescription drug affordability programs.
  4. Collect program utilization data and prepare ad hoc, monthly and annual reports.
  5. Community and provider outreach to increase awareness of the prescription assistance program.
  6. Obtain and subsequently maintain Maine Enrollment Assister and State Health Insurance Program (SHIP) Counselor Certification.
  7. Screen patients for eligibility for state and federal programs and assist with applications for Medicare, Medicare Savings Program, MaineCare, and Marketplace.
  8. During the annual Open Enrollment Period, review Medicare and Marketplace options with patients and complete enrollments.
  9. Support Health Care Help Center team, as needed:
  10. Good Faith Estimates (GFEs).
  11. Patient outreach for those patients listed on the self-pay report.

Education/Licensure/Certifications/Qualifications:

  1. Bachelor or Associate degree in social services, pharmacy, or the healthcare field preferred or relevant experience in the healthcare environment.
  2. Maine Enrollment Assister and State Health Insurance Program (SHIP) Counselor Certification (can be obtained upon employment).
